Ancient Memories, by Janet K. Burner
Ancient Memories

Janet K. Burner

Clay, pastels, sculpture

I began my career in clay, drawing, and sculpture in 1970, opening my first shop, Sabino Stoneware Pottery, on Meyer Avenue in Barrio Viejo in 1972. I currently teach at "Romero House Potters" on the Tucson Museum of Art campus (since 1972) and also recently at Lew Sorensen Community Center. In clay, my work is functional as well as sculptural. Figure drawing has always been of interest. I love the feel of clay as it is created by my hands into the vessel of my choosing. I prefer to sell my own work so as to meet and interact with the person who admires my expertise.

Visual Tautologies series, by Alvaro Enciso
Visual Tautologies series

Alvaro Enciso

Mixed media

My current work, using mostly discarded tin cans found in remote areas of the Sonoran desert, deals with current issues such as the constant search for the elusive "American dream", the crossing of borders, both geographical as well as emotional, and how these acts of trespassing inform social and personal identity. In the borderlands, the role of the outsider is not always clear: who belongs and who is the "other" is always a matter of negotiation.

JAGUAR in steel, in work, by Pat Frederick
JAGUAR in steel, in work

Pat Frederick

Steel

This year is the JAGUAR PROJECT.

Two big cats to call attention to Sky Island Alliance and the Northern Jaguar Project. I have dedicated the year to make them and show them and when they sell, donate to each of the two conservation groups that create safety for Jaguars to breed (in Mexico) and the Sky Island Alliance, which promotes good water sources, natural plantings, fire and climate change studies and linkages that allow the cats to wander north when they feel like it on open pathways.

I will have information for what makes the Jaguar Project so worthwhile that I would give up a year of my business.

I am hoping that you will become interested in jaguars too.
